QTable是允许您以表格方式显示数据的组件。 通常称为数据表。 它包含以下主要功能: 过滤 排序 具有自定义选择操作的单行/多行选择 分页(如果需要,包括服务器端) 网格模式(例如,您可以使用QCard以非表格方式显示数据) 通过有限范围的插槽,对行和单元格进行全面定制 能够在数据行的顶部或底部添加额外的行 列选取器(...
数据表(Data Table) QTable是一个允许您以表格方式显示数据的组件。 特征:过滤 排序 具有自定义选择操作的单行/多行选择 分页(如果需要,包括服务器端) 通过有限范围的插槽, 对行和单元格进行全面定制 能够在数据行的顶部或底部添加额外的行 列选取器(通过本页其中一节中描述的QTableColumns组件) 自定义顶部或...
数据表(Data Table) QTable是一个允许您以表格方式显示数据的组件。 特征:过滤 排序 具有自定义选择操作的单行/多行选择 分页(如果需要,包括服务器端) 通过有限范围的插槽, 对行和单元格进行全面定制 能够在数据行的顶部或底部添加额外的行 列选取器(通过本页其中一节中描述的QTableColumns组件) 自定义顶部或...
quasar q-table 的用法 Quasar Q-table是Quasar框架中的一个组件,用于展示和处理数据的表格。它是基于HTML的table元素进行构建的,并支持各种交互功能,例如排序、过滤和分页等。 使用Quasar Q-table,你可以轻松地在你的应用程序中呈现数据,并根据需要进行排序和筛选。这个组件提供了一些属性和方法,让你可以自定义表格...
</q-th> </q-tr> </template> </q-table> </template> <script setup> import{computed,reactive}from'vue'; letfilter=reactive({}); letfilterTerms=computed(()=>{ returngetFilterTerms(filter); }); constgetFilterTerms=(filter)=>{
在Quasar中,可以通过使用scoped slots来自定义QTable单元格的样式。scoped slots是一种Vue.js的特性,允许我们在父组件中定义子组件的内容和行为。 要有条件地设置QTable单元格的样式,可以使用QTable的scoped slots中的body-cell插槽。在这个插槽中,我们可以访问到每个单元格的数据和索引,从而根据条件来设置样式。
我正在尝试制作 Quasar 表,每行都有按钮,打开适合 QMenu: 它可以工作,但我需要仅通过单击按钮来打开 QMenu。 <template v-slot:body-cell-name="props" > <q-td :props="props"> <q-btn icon="menu" @click="" dense flat></q-btn> </q-td> <q-menu fit> Blah Blah Blah<br> Blah Blah ...
在Quasar 框架中,如果你想在表格内容和分页组件之间添加自定义内容,可以按照以下步骤进行操作: 确定quasar 表格和分页组件的布局位置: 首先,确保你已经正确地在页面上放置了 Quasar 的表格(q-table)和分页(q-pagination)组件。 创建一个新的内容区域,并确定其要插入的位置: 在你的 Vue 组件中,定义一个新的部分来...
这里我记录一下使用QTable 数据表及QPagination组件来实现想要的数据表格及分页的过程。 可直接跳至文章末尾,看实现效果:传送门。 QTable 数据表 首先,从文档:QTable中能看到很多种表格样式,找到一款与我们的项目UI效果相似的来使用: 示例 <q-table title="Treats" ...
Quasar是一个基于Vue.js的前端框架,它提供了丰富的组件和工具来简化开发过程。Q表是Quasar框架中的一个表格组件,用于展示和操作数据。实现服务端分页的Quasar Q表可以通过以下步骤完成...